This dataset provides Census 2021 estimates that classify usual residents in England and Wales by religion. The estimates are as at Census Day, 21 March 2021.
Summary
The religion people connect or identify with (their religious affiliation), whether or not they practice or have belief in it.
This question was voluntary and includes people who identified with one of 8 tick-box response options, including ‘No religion’, alongside those who chose not to answer this question.
Religion: Total: All usual residents | 321 |
---|---|
No religion | 112 |
Christian | 179 |
Buddhist | 0 |
Hindu | 0 |
Jewish | 0 |
Muslim | 0 |
Sikh | 0 |
Other religion | 3 |
Not answered | 27 |
